Homemade Dog Food for the Sensitive Stomach: 7 Easy Recipes

This post contains affiliate links and we will be compensated if you buy after clicking on our links.

Dry kibbles and canned food products that you find lining the shelves of your local pet store are designed to appeal to the masses. They’re convenient and formulated to provide dogs with a balanced diet.

Unfortunately, not all dogs can benefit from them.

All dogs are unique and respond to foods in different ways. Food allergies are quite common. While one popular ingredient may be fine for most dogs, it could also cause diarrhea and general stomach upsets for others.

If your dog has a sensitive stomach, you may be better off sticking to homemade meals.

By making food from scratch, you have full control over what your pup eats. You can easily avoid those offending ingredients and give your canine companion a delicious meal that’s healthy for them.

Whether you’re new to the world of homemade dog food or you’re a seasoned chef looking for new recipes, we have you covered.

Here are some great recipes for homemade dog food that’s great for dogs with a sensitive stomach.

#1.  Rice and Chicken Meal

This is a simple recipe that only requires a single large pot. If your rice cooker can handle it, you may even be able to use that. The base of this homemade recipe is lean chicken and white rice.

Both ingredients are easy to digest. The chicken is also a nice source of pure protein to keep the muscles healthy.

For vegetables, we recommend sticking with a simple medley of peas and carrots. You can use fresh or frozen.

Just avoid any mix that has onions, garlic, or anything else that’s harmful to dogs.


  • 2 cups of white rice
  • 1+1/2 pounds of lean chicken
  • 1+1/2 cups of vegetables
  • 4 and a half cups of water


All you have to do is add all of the ingredients to a large pot and place it over medium heat. Bring the mixture up to a boil and cover the pot. Let the food simmer for about 15 minutes.

Make sure to stir it occasionally to prevent the rice from sticking. Once the rice is nice and fluffy, let the meal cool down completely before feeding it to your pup

#2.  Tuna and Sweet Potato Mash

With only three ingredients, this recipe is very simple and easy on the stomach. It uses canned tuna, a protein source that’s readily available and very good for your dog.

It’s filled with omega fatty acids and has a ton of great protein.

Go with tuna that’s unseasoned and oil-free. There are also sweet potatoes, which is a complex carb that’s absorbed slowly for a full day of energy.


  • 1 cup of canned tuna in water
  • Half a cup of sweet potatoes
  • 1 tablespoon of olive oil


Start by peeling the sweet potato and cutting it up into small squares. Measure out half a cup and boil the pieces in a large pot until they can be pierced with a fork. Then, drain them and let them cool.

Mash the potatoes up with a fork.

As your potatoes are boiling, you can prepare the tuna. All you need to do is drain the excess liquid.

Once your potatoes have cooled, simply mix in the tuna and add the oil.

#3.  Chicken and Mashed Potatoes

This recipe uses simple ground chicken and potatoes to create a filling meal. You can use standard potatoes or sweet potatoes. The same goes for cottage cheese or yogurt.

Both are filled with probiotics to help keep your dog’s gut in good shape.


  • Half a pound of ground chicken
  • 1 cup of potatoes
  • 1 and a half tablespoons of cottage cheese or yogurt
  • Half a cup of carrots


Begin by cutting up the potatoes in small chunks for easy boiling. Then, boil them up until they fall apart easily.

Once you’ve drained them, mash them up. Then, grate the carrots into fine pieces.

In a separate pan, cook the minced chicken and carrots. The chicken should be cooked thoroughly until there is no pink left.

With the heat off, incorporate the mashed potato into the chicken. Mix this up nicely to create a thick mash and let the meal cool off.

Once cooled, mix in your cottage cheese or yogurt and serve it up.

#4.  Baked Treats

Want to make a rewarding treat from scratch? This recipe contains several ingredients. They’re all healthy for dogs and can usually appease pups with sensitive stomachs.

The recipe uses peanut butter as a binder and grated carrots for an extra boost of vitamins.


  • 1 cup of rice flour
  • 1 cup of oats
  • 1/4 of a cup of low-sodium beef broth
  • 3 ounces of organic peanut butter
  • Half a cup of grated carrots
  • 1 tablespoon of baking powder
  • 4 tablespoons of olive oil


Despite the long ingredient list, these treats are easy to make. Heat up your oven to about 350 degrees Fahrenheit (about 175 degrees Celsius).

Prepare a baking sheet by greasing it with olive oil.

In one bowl, combine the flour, oats, baking powder, and carrots. In a separate large bowl, combine the rest of the wet ingredients. Then, add the dry ingredients to the wet.

Mix the ingredients until you get a thick and smooth mixture. Then, plop them onto your baking sheet and pop them in the oven for about 15 minutes.

#5.  Chicken and Pumpkin Mix

Here’s another great recipe that uses chicken and white rice as its base. The unique thing about this food is that it uses plain canned pumpkin.

Pumpkin is a great ingredient for dogs with a sensitive stomach. It has plenty of vitamins, acts as a source of fiber, and absorbs slowly into the body.


  • 1 and a half cups of white rice
  • Half a cup of lean chicken chunks
  • 1/4 of a cup of yogurt
  • 1/4 of a cup of plain canned pumpkin


First things first, you should start by cooking the rice separately. Follow the instructions on the package or use a rice cooker. As the rice cooks, you can prepare your chicken.

The chicken should already be in manageable chunks. Just cook the chicken in a pot with a bit of water until it’s soft and opaque.

After transferring the chicken to a large bowl, shred it. Let everything cool down before adding the rest of the ingredients and the cooked rice.

#6.  Ground Beef Meal

Nothing can get dogs salivating quite like ground beef. The ingredient is filled with high-quality protein. The recipe also calls for boiled eggs, which add even more protein into the mix.

You can substitute the cottage cheese for yogurt and use any plain beans you have. Make sure to soften them first if you are using dried beans.


  • 1 cup of ground beef
  • Half a cup of plain oatmeal
  • 2 eggs
  • 2 tablespoons of cottage cheese
  • 3 tablespoons of plain beans
  • 3 tablespoons of grated carrots


The first thing you need to do is hardboil the eggs and prepare the oatmeal. Let the eggs cool and chop them up into small chunks. Then, cook off the beef.

Remove any excess oil and let the meat cool down. Once that’s all done, just mix the ingredients up to create a mash.

#7.  Turkey, Egg, and Rice Cakes

This recipe makes small cakes. You can easily portion out your dog’s meals. It uses turkey as a base. Ground turkey is a great alternative to chicken or beef.

It’s low on fat but high in protein. For plenty of vitamins and minerals, the recipe utilizes a nice collection of plant-based ingredients as well.


  • 2 pounds of ground turkey
  • 2 eggs
  • 3 cups of white rice
  • 3 diced carrots
  • 1 diced apple


Preheat your oven to 375 degrees Fahrenheit (about 190 degrees Celsius).

As your oven is heating up, simply combine all of the ingredients in a large bowl. Then, use olive oil or coconut oil to grease up a muffin pan.

Pack the mixture into the muffin pan cups. Don’t use cupcake liners. The grease will only cause them to disintegrate.

Pop the muffin pan into the oven and bake for about half an hour. It’s a good idea to use a standard baking tray underneath the muffin tin just in case any oil seeps out.

Once the cakes have cooled off, they’re ready for munching.

What Food Ingredients Are Good For Dogs with Sensitive Stomaches?

The beauty of making your dog’s meals at home is that you’re free to experiment.

Here’s a list of ingredients that are good for dogs with a sensitive stomach. As long as you stick with the basics and avoid any harmful ingredients, you should be good to go.

  • Lean chicken
  • Turkey breast
  • Sweet potato
  • Bone broth – see recipe
  • Boiled white potatoes
  • Yogurt
  • Cottage cheese
  • Canned tuna in water
  • White rice
  • Mashed pumpkin
  • Season-free baby food


Making your dog’s meals from scratch is a great way to keep their stomach upsets to a minimum. As always, consult with your vet before you make any major changes to your dog’s diet.

With the right balance of wholesome ingredients, your dog will be able to enjoy delicious meals without the pain and diarrhea.

Also Read: Best Food Brands for Puppies with Sensitive Stomachs

thank you for sharing puppy

Sharing is Caring

Help spread the word. You're awesome for doing it!